factorial Mathematics — noun the product of an integer and all the integers below it; e.g. factorial four (4!) is equal to 24. (Symbol: !) ↘the product of a series of factors in an arithmetical progression. adjective relating to a factor or factorial. Derivatives… … English new terms dictionary

factorial — factorially, adv. /fak tawr ee euhl, tohr /, n. 1. Math. the product of a given positive integer multiplied by all lesser positive integers: The quantity four factorial (4!) = 4 · 3 · 2 · 1 = 24. Symbol: n!, where n is the given integer. adj. 2.… … Universalium
